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Kelly Dulek conducted a Pre-Licensing Inspection with Applicant Representatives Jep Stokes, Antonio Reyes, Tiai Salanoa and Administrator Leopoldo (Leo) Vaca. An Application to operate a Social Rehabilitation Facility (SRF) was received by Community Care Licensing (CCL) on 03/10/2022. A Fire Clearance was approved for a maximum capacity of six (6) ambulatory residents on 05/12/2022.

The proposed physical plant is a two (2) story single family dwelling located in a residential neighborhood of Santa Rosa Valley, CA. A tour of the physical plant was conducted and the following observed:

COMMON AREAS: These include the Family Room and Dining Room. Additionally, the attached 3-car garage will be used as a Gym/Recreation Room. The common areas were furnished to accommodate a maximum capacity of six (6) residents. There is a fireplace in the Family Room as well as Family Therapy Room, which were observed to be adequately screened and Licensee Representative stated is disabled. There were no immediate hazards observed. A COVID-19 Screening & Hand Sanitizing Station was observed at the entrance to the facility. Fire extinguishers were observed throughout the facility; all were observed to be fully charged and last serviced 03/31/2022. At 11:00AM, hardwired combination carbon monoxide/smoke detectors were tested and were functional at the time of the visit.

TREATMENT/THERAPY, MEDICATION ROOM & OFFICE AREAS: There is a Group/Family Room, Family Therapy Room, Medication Room, and two (2) offices located on the ground floor. There is also a Learning Lab located on the second story as well as one (1) additional office. Medications are stored in a locked first floor Medication Room. The medication room has adequate locked storage, as well as a locked refrigerator. The 1st Aid Kit is stored in the Medication Room. The Offices are kept inaccessible to clients unless properly supervised.

LAUNDRY: Locked Laundry Room is located on the ground floor. Laundry and cleaning supplies will be stored in locked closet inside the locked Laundry Room.

KITCHEN: Appliances and fixtures appeared clean and functional. Licensee representative informed LPA three (3) of the four (4) burners on the stove are non-functional and will be repaired within the week. LPA confirmed the one (1) burner was functional at the time of the visit. There was sufficient nonperishable food to accommodate a maximum capacity of 6 Clients for (seven) 7 days. There was sufficient dining and cook ware to accommodate a maximum capacity of 6 Clients. Cleaning supplies will be stored in locked under-sink cabinets. Knives and other sharps will be stored in a locked cabinet in an inaccessible office. There were no visible immediate hazards observed.

BEDROOMS: There are three (3) Bedrooms, all of which are designated for Resident use. All bedrooms are located on the second story and furnished for double occupancy. All bedrooms were equipped and supplied with appropriate furniture, bedding and linens. There were no visible hazards or discrepancies observed.

BATHROOMS: There are five (5) Bathrooms, two (2) on the ground floor and three (3) on the second floor. The bathrooms located on the ground floor include a full bath attached to the office designated for client use and a half bath in the main hallway for staff use. The bathrooms located on the second floor are all full bathrooms and two (2) are designated for client use. 1 upstairs bathroom is designated for staff use only. All Bathrooms were supplied with appropriate paper and hygiene products. Water temperatures were measured in all client bathrooms and measured within the required range of 105 degrees F to 120 degrees F at the time of the visit.

SURROUNDING GROUNDS: The Front Yard includes a driveway, paved walkways and landscaped areas. The backyard is fenced and includes both paved and landscaped areas, a patio, furniture appropriate for outdoor use, shade an in-ground swimming pool, as well as a stable and barn, and open space. The pool is kept inaccessible to clients with the use of fencing that includes a locked gate. The Applicant Representative and Administrator confirmed they are aware of the requirement of Water Safety Certification for staff providing supervision during pool use and that qualified staff must be present at all times that the pool is in use by clients. COMPONENT II/COMPONENT III ORIENTATION: A Component II Orientation was completed telephonically with the Licensee Representative and Administrator on 05/24/2022. A Component III Orientation was conducted with Licensee Representative Tiai Salanoa and Administrator Leo Vaca during today's visit.

COVID-19 MITIGATION PLAN REPORT: During today’s visit, LPA reviewed the facility’s Plan for Epidemic Outbreak specific to COVID-19 Mitigation Plan Report.

The following needs to be completed/Photos sent to LPA prior to licensure:

  • Remove all debris/potential hazardous items from the outdoor space, including all loose concrete, cinder blocks, and bricks
  • Remove protruding re-bar from the concrete slab/wall in the outdoor open space
  • Replace the 4 (four) missing screens that are currently missing and are on order

This report will be sent to the Centralized Application Bureau (CAB). You will be notified by the CAB Analyst when your license has been approved. You are not allowed to begin operating until you have been notified that your license has been approved by the CAB Analyst. Failure to comply could affect approval of your license.

Exit interview conducted. A copy of the Licensing Report was provided via email.
